RELENE® L 60040

High Density Polyethylene

Supplied by Reliance Industries Limited

Product Description
Relene L 60040 is a UV stabilised narrow molecular weight distribution high density polyethylene grade suitable for injection molding applications. This grade exhibits very high impact strength, high gloss, good dimensional stability and superior ESCR properties. Relene L 60040 is recommended for applications where articles are exposed to sunlight like jumbo crates for fisheries, helmets, paint-pails, etc.
